Реклама на сайте English version  DatasheetsDatasheets

KAZUS.RU - Электронный портал. Принципиальные схемы, Datasheets, Форум по электронике

Новости электроники Новости Литература, электронные книги Литература Документация, даташиты Документация Поиск даташитов (datasheets)Поиск PDF
  От производителей
Новости поставщиков
В мире электроники

  Сборник статей
Электронные книги
FAQ по электронике

  Datasheets
Поиск SMD
Он-лайн справочник

Принципиальные схемы Схемы Каталоги программ, сайтов Каталоги Общение, форум Общение Ваш аккаунтАккаунт
  Каталог схем
Избранные схемы
FAQ по электронике
  Программы
Каталог сайтов
Производители электроники
  Форумы по электронике
Помощь проекту


 
Опции темы
Непрочитано 04.03.2013, 21:46  
Андрей К
Почётный гражданин KAZUS.RU
 
Аватар для Андрей К
 
Регистрация: 10.11.2009
Адрес: Свердловская область, г. Ирбит
Сообщений: 4,003
Сказал спасибо: 165
Сказали Спасибо 1,243 раз(а) в 733 сообщении(ях)
Андрей К на пути к лучшему
По умолчанию Re: PIC12C508 и PIC12F508

Сообщение от dosikus Посмотреть сообщение
Можно в эмуляторе прогнать предварительно...
я не знаю как это делается..

Сообщение от dosikus Посмотреть сообщение
Секретная ?
Да нее... Просто ссылка на описание того что надо сделать и сама прошивка есть у него... Моё дело только вогнать прошиву чтоб заработало.
Реклама:
__________________
"У принца Лимона всё наоборот: воры и убийцы у него во дворце, а в тюрьме сидят честные граждане" (с) Дж. Родари "Приключения Чипполино"
Андрей К вне форума  
Непрочитано 04.03.2013, 21:53  
dosikus
Гуру портала
 
Аватар для dosikus
 
Регистрация: 20.11.2004
Сообщений: 10,015
Сказал спасибо: 936
Сказали Спасибо 2,269 раз(а) в 1,563 сообщении(ях)
dosikus на пути к лучшему
По умолчанию Re: PIC12C508 и PIC12F508

Андрей К, Кидай со схемой .
__________________
Осторожно , злой кот
dosikus вне форума  
Непрочитано 04.03.2013, 21:56  
Андрей К
Почётный гражданин KAZUS.RU
 
Аватар для Андрей К
 
Регистрация: 10.11.2009
Адрес: Свердловская область, г. Ирбит
Сообщений: 4,003
Сказал спасибо: 165
Сказали Спасибо 1,243 раз(а) в 733 сообщении(ях)
Андрей К на пути к лучшему
По умолчанию Re: PIC12C508 и PIC12F508

Сообщение от dosikus Посмотреть сообщение
Кидай со схемой
Только завтра скину всё...
__________________
"У принца Лимона всё наоборот: воры и убийцы у него во дворце, а в тюрьме сидят честные граждане" (с) Дж. Родари "Приключения Чипполино"
Андрей К вне форума  
Непрочитано 04.03.2013, 22:23  
dosikus
Гуру портала
 
Аватар для dosikus
 
Регистрация: 20.11.2004
Сообщений: 10,015
Сказал спасибо: 936
Сказали Спасибо 2,269 раз(а) в 1,563 сообщении(ях)
dosikus на пути к лучшему
По умолчанию Re: PIC12C508 и PIC12F508

Сообщение от dosikus Посмотреть сообщение
Эта ? http://chipi.ru/hex/hex.html
Если это оно, то можно и в 12F508 модифицировать...
Код:
  processor 12C508
    #include ‹P12C508.INC›
    __config _MCLRE_OFF & _CP_OFF & _WDT_OFF & _XT_OSC ; 0x0FE9

; RAM-Variable
LRAM_0x07 equ 0x07
LRAM_0x08 equ 0x08
LRAM_0x09 equ 0x09
LRAM_0x0A equ 0x0A
LRAM_0x0B equ 0x0B
LRAM_0x0C equ 0x0C
LRAM_0x0D equ 0x0D
LRAM_0x0E equ 0x0E

; Program

    Org 0x0000

;   Reset-Vector
    MOVWF OSCCAL
    GOTO LADR_0x0100
LADR_0x0002
    MOVLW 0x32           ;   b'00110010'  d'050'  "2"
LADR_0x0003
    MOVWF LRAM_0x0A
LADR_0x0004
    MOVLW 0xF9           ;   b'11111001'  d'249'
    MOVWF LRAM_0x0B
LADR_0x0006
    NOP
    DECFSZ LRAM_0x0B,F
    GOTO LADR_0x0006
    BTFSS LRAM_0x0E,0
    GOTO LADR_0x000F
    MOVLW 0x25           ;   b'00100101'  d'037'  "%"
    MOVWF LRAM_0x0B
LADR_0x000D
    DECFSZ LRAM_0x0B,F
    GOTO LADR_0x000D
LADR_0x000F
    DECFSZ LRAM_0x0A,F
    GOTO LADR_0x0004
    RETLW 0x03           ;   b'00000011'  d'003'
LADR_0x0012
    MOVWF LRAM_0x07
LADR_0x0013
    MOVLW 0x48           ;   b'01001000'  d'072'  "H"
    CALL LADR_0x0003
    MOVLW 0x04           ;   b'00000100'  d'004'
    MOVWF LRAM_0x08
LADR_0x0017
    MOVF LRAM_0x0D,W
    CALL LADR_0x0037
    MOVWF LRAM_0x0C
    COMF LRAM_0x0C,F
    MOVLW 0x08           ;   b'00001000'  d'008'
    MOVWF LRAM_0x09
    MOVLW 0xFB           ;   b'11111011'  d'251'
    TRIS GPIO
    MOVLW 0x04           ;   b'00000100'  d'004'
    CALL LADR_0x0003
LADR_0x0021
    RRF LRAM_0x0C,F
    MOVLW 0xF9           ;   b'11111001'  d'249'
    MOVWF GPIO
    BTFSC STATUS,C
    MOVLW 0xFB           ;   b'11111011'  d'251'
    BTFSS STATUS,C
    MOVLW 0xF9           ;   b'11111001'  d'249'
    TRIS GPIO
    MOVLW 0x04           ;   b'00000100'  d'004'
    CALL LADR_0x0003
    DECFSZ LRAM_0x09,F
    GOTO LADR_0x0021
    MOVLW 0xF9           ;   b'11111001'  d'249'
    TRIS GPIO
    MOVLW 0x08           ;   b'00001000'  d'008'
    CALL LADR_0x0003
    INCF LRAM_0x0D,F
    DECFSZ LRAM_0x08,F
    GOTO LADR_0x0017
    DECFSZ LRAM_0x07,F
    GOTO LADR_0x0013
    RETLW 0x03           ;   b'00000011'  d'003'
LADR_0x0037
    ADDWF PCL,F          ; !!Program-Counter-Modification
    RETLW 0x53           ;   b'01010011'  d'083'  "S"
    RETLW 0x43           ;   b'01000011'  d'067'  "C"
    RETLW 0x45           ;   b'01000101'  d'069'  "E"
    RETLW 0x49           ;   b'01001001'  d'073'  "I"
    RETLW 0x53           ;   b'01010011'  d'083'  "S"
    RETLW 0x43           ;   b'01000011'  d'067'  "C"
    RETLW 0x45           ;   b'01000101'  d'069'  "E"
    RETLW 0x41           ;   b'01000001'  d'065'  "A"
    RETLW 0x53           ;   b'01010011'  d'083'  "S"
    RETLW 0x43           ;   b'01000011'  d'067'  "C"
    RETLW 0x45           ;   b'01000101'  d'069'  "E"
    RETLW 0x45           ;   b'01000101'  d'069'  "E"

    Org 0x0100

LADR_0x0100
    MOVLW 0xC2           ;   b'11000010'  d'194'
    OPTION
    MOVLW 0xFF           ;   b'11111111'  d'255'
    TRIS GPIO
    CLRF LRAM_0x0E
    CALL LADR_0x0002
    BCF GPIO,GP1
    MOVLW 0xFD           ;   b'11111101'  d'253'
    TRIS GPIO
    MOVLW 0x11           ;   b'00010001'  d'017'
    MOVWF LRAM_0x07
LADR_0x010B
    CALL LADR_0x0002
    DECFSZ LRAM_0x07,F
    GOTO LADR_0x010B
    BCF GPIO,GP2
    MOVLW 0xF9           ;   b'11111001'  d'249'
    TRIS GPIO
    MOVLW 0x06           ;   b'00000110'  d'006'
    MOVWF LRAM_0x07
LADR_0x0113
    CALL LADR_0x0002
    DECFSZ LRAM_0x07,F
    GOTO LADR_0x0113
    MOVLW 0x0E           ;   b'00001110'  d'014'
    CALL LADR_0x0003
LADR_0x0118
    CLRF LRAM_0x0D
    CALL LADR_0x0012
    INCF LRAM_0x0E,F
    GOTO LADR_0x0118

    End
__________________
Осторожно , злой кот
dosikus вне форума  
Непрочитано 07.03.2013, 09:49  
Андрей К
Почётный гражданин KAZUS.RU
 
Аватар для Андрей К
 
Регистрация: 10.11.2009
Адрес: Свердловская область, г. Ирбит
Сообщений: 4,003
Сказал спасибо: 165
Сказали Спасибо 1,243 раз(а) в 733 сообщении(ях)
Андрей К на пути к лучшему
По умолчанию Re: PIC12C508 и PIC12F508

Сообщение от dosikus Посмотреть сообщение
Эта ? http://chipi.ru/hex/hex.html
Я не знаю Лёша как ты догадался, но это именно тот источник, о котором мне коллега говорил... Прошивка самая верхняя для С508А
__________________
"У принца Лимона всё наоборот: воры и убийцы у него во дворце, а в тюрьме сидят честные граждане" (с) Дж. Родари "Приключения Чипполино"
Андрей К вне форума  
Непрочитано 07.03.2013, 12:04  
SSH
Частый гость
 
Регистрация: 11.03.2005
Сообщений: 27
Сказал спасибо: 0
Сказали Спасибо 2 раз(а) в 2 сообщении(ях)
SSH на пути к лучшему
По умолчанию Re: PIC12C508 и PIC12F508

PicKit2 с последним dat-файлом поддерживает линейку 12F, 508-й в том числе. Ничто не мешает прошить и посмотреть. Ну и поанализировать нужно, на предмет 100%-ной совместимости. И ещё я чего-то недопонял. Какой камень прошить-то нужно?

Последний раз редактировалось SSH; 07.03.2013 в 12:13.
SSH вне форума  
Непрочитано 07.03.2013, 12:16  
SSH
Частый гость
 
Регистрация: 11.03.2005
Сообщений: 27
Сказал спасибо: 0
Сказали Спасибо 2 раз(а) в 2 сообщении(ях)
SSH на пути к лучшему
По умолчанию Re: PIC12C508 и PIC12F508

Сообщение от omercury Посмотреть сообщение
Как говорится - "Хозяин - барин!"
Вот и мучайся со своим пиккитом. Хотя, по большому счёту, если сумеешь вот в этом месте заменить параметры на PIC12C508, то должно случиться чудо.
А мож и добавить можно "неподдерживаемый" контроллер - не знаю.
А про PICkit2 Device File Editor Вы не слышали? Вот это место вообще меня изрядно повеселило "Вот и мучайся со своим пиккитом". И это - после разных убогих JDM-ов.
SSH вне форума  
Непрочитано 07.03.2013, 12:21  
Андрей К
Почётный гражданин KAZUS.RU
 
Аватар для Андрей К
 
Регистрация: 10.11.2009
Адрес: Свердловская область, г. Ирбит
Сообщений: 4,003
Сказал спасибо: 165
Сказали Спасибо 1,243 раз(а) в 733 сообщении(ях)
Андрей К на пути к лучшему
По умолчанию Re: PIC12C508 и PIC12F508

SSH, привет микрочипсю!
__________________
"У принца Лимона всё наоборот: воры и убийцы у него во дворце, а в тюрьме сидят честные граждане" (с) Дж. Родари "Приключения Чипполино"
Андрей К вне форума  
Непрочитано 07.03.2013, 12:33  
SSH
Частый гость
 
Регистрация: 11.03.2005
Сообщений: 27
Сказал спасибо: 0
Сказали Спасибо 2 раз(а) в 2 сообщении(ях)
SSH на пути к лучшему
По умолчанию Re: PIC12C508 и PIC12F508

И тебе привет.
SSH вне форума  
 

Закладки
Опции темы

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.

Быстрый переход

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
TMR0 pic12c508 cnc10 Микроконтроллеры, АЦП, память и т.д 7 30.04.2009 20:23
PIC12C508/509 = PIC12F629/675 ??? Михаил Микроконтроллеры, АЦП, память и т.д 8 07.12.2003 22:28


Часовой пояс GMT +4, время: 00:24.


Powered by vBulletin® Version 3.8.4
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d. Перевод: zCarot